Australia Fluoroelastomer Market

Australia's market for fluoroelastomers consists of high-performance synthetic rubber products that offer outstanding heat, chemical, fuel, and oil resistance. New applications in the automotive, aerospace, oil and gas, chemical processing, and semiconductor industries have driven increased demand and are contributing to the continued growth of this product category across Australia. The increasing usage of seals, gaskets, O-rings, and hoses, together with the rise of industrialization and stringent performance requirements, has led to the use of advanced materials in high-temperature applications, which supports continued growth in this market.

 

The fluoroelastomer market in Australia is supported by the government's backing for advanced materials and chemical manufacturing. The R&D Tax Incentive is one of the major initiatives that aid in cutting down the development costs, while the Industry Growth Program (AUD 400 million) and Future Made in Australia policy (AUD 22.7 billion) are there to support scale-up and develop new technologies. The regulatory frameworks like AICIS are ensuring safe use of the new chemical formulations, thus indirectly promoting the development and usage of domestic fluoroelastomer.

Market Dynamics of the Australia Fluoroelastomer Market:

The Australia fluoroelastomer market is driven by the increasing need for these materials in the automotive, aerospace, oil & gas, and chemical processing industries that have the requirement of excellent performance in terms of heat, chemical, and fuel resistance. The demand is also supported by the growth of industrial manufacturing, the increase in the use of high-performance seals and gaskets, and the enforcement of safety and performance standards. Moreover, the energy sector's infrastructure expansion and the use of advanced materials in high-temperature and corrosive environments are among the factors that promote the gradual increase of the market size.

 

The Australia fluoroelastomer market is restrained by the high prices of raw materials and the production process, the lack of local manufacturing capacity, and the reliance on imports. The situation is compounded by the strict environmental laws, complicated chemical compliance regulations, and the price fluctuations of fluorine-based input materials, which are also factors that limit the market's growth.

 

The Australian fluoroelastomer market has the future potential of developing a variety of low-emission and sustainable formulations, with the rising use in electric vehicles, hydrogen energy, and renewable infrastructure. Besides, the consumption of high-temperature, chemical-resistant elastomers, lightweight sealing solutions, and the use of advanced compounding technologies will be the major contributors to the business growth in aerospace, oil & gas, and semiconductor applications.

By Type:

The Australia fluoroelastomer market is divided by type into fluorocarbon, fluorosilicone, and perfluoroelastomers. Among these, the fluorocarbon segment dominated the share in 2024 and is anticipated to grow at a remarkable CAGR during the forecast period. Its superior resistance to heat, fuels, lubricants, and chemicals, as well as its wide range of applications in automotive, oil and gas, chemical processing, and industrial sealing, are the reasons for its dominance.

 

By End Use:

The Australia fluoroelastomer market is divided by end use into automotive, aerospace, chemicals, oil & gas, energy & power, and others. Among these, the automotive segment accounted for the largest share in 2024 and is projected to grow at a significant CAGR during the forecast period. Strong demand for high-performance seals, gaskets, hoses, and O-rings that can tolerate high temperatures, fuels, lubricants, and aggressive automotive fluids is what propels this supremacy. The automotive segment's dominant position is further supported by growing vehicle production, a greater emphasis on emission control systems, and an expansion in the use of electric and hybrid vehicles, which call for robust, heat-resistant elastomer components.

Recent Developments in Australia Fluoroelastomer Market:

In July 2025, the launch of new AFLAS FFKM fluoroelastomer conditions with better resistance to heat, chemicals, and plasma was the event that happened in the semiconductor manufacturing area, where advanced sealing applications were supported.

 

In March 2025, Syensqo introduced a new range of perfluoroelastomers produced with non-fluorosurfactant technology, thus meeting the sustainability and performance requirements in extreme applications.
